Founded in 2010, The Arcview Group is the first and largest group of investors dedicated to the legal cannabis industry. Since inception, 1200+ dues-paying accredited investors have placed $160+ million behind 170+ companies that have come through the network. Companies such as Eaze, Tokyo Smoke, Mjardin, SPARC, Mirth, Flowhub, Leaf, Wurk, Meadow, Medicine Man, The Goodship, Steep Hill, Growcentia, and many others raised capital from the group. ADVFN (www.advfn.com) is a global stocks, shares and crypto information website providing market-leading financial tools and data to private investors around the world.
Offering real-time share prices, news feeds, charting, portfolio management, monitor lists, financials, data from global stock exchanges, Level 2 and the most active financial bulletin board in the UK (along with many other features), the site is the destination of choice for day traders and retail investors.
Established in the last quarter of 1999, ADVFN (LSE:AFN) was floated on the London Stock Exchange’s AIM market in March 2000. The site currently has approximately 36 million users worldwide and a billion page impressions a year.
Originally a UK-based site, the company currently operates in the US (as InvestorsHub.com ) UK, Brazil, Japan and Dubai. ADVFN has a joint venture in Brazil, a country in which ADVFN has a geographic and language targeted website. This is in addition to its US, French, German, Italian, Canadian, Japanese, Indian, Mexican and Filipino ADVFN financial sites.
